#f69124 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f69124 is composed of 96.5% red, 56.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 31.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 55.3%. #f69124 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#ed2300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f69124 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f69124 has RGB values of R:246, G:145,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.85,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16159012.

Shades and Tints of #f69124
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f69124
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968d84 is the less saturated color, while #ff911b is the most saturated one.
